To the Pupils of the "Central School" Buffalo[, New York] "Fort Donelson Is Ours" [1862] Patriotic Song & Chorus Words by Amanda T. Jones. Music by Cha[rle[s. G. Degenhard. New York, NY: FIRTH, POND & CO., 547 Broadway Boston, MA: O. DITSON & CO. Buffalo, NY: BLOGETT & BRADFORD. Pittsburgh, PA: H. KLEBER & BRO. Syracuse, NY: T. HOUGH.
